San Francisco Business Times: California's Trounson Affair Damages Likelihood of Future Stem Cell Funding
The San Francisco Business Times yesterday said the Trounson Affair is the “latest embarrassment” for the $3 billion California stem cell agency and threatens its attempts at securing additional funding.
